    AnnotationDirect C–H arylation of purines to position 8 by diverse aryl halides was achieved using Pd catalysis in the presence of CuI and Cs2CO3. The methodology was applied in consecutive regioselective synthesis of 2,6,8-trisubstituted purines bearing three different C-substituents in combination with two cross-coupling reaction. In addition, direct arylation of unprotected purine nucleosides with aryl iodides at position 8 was developed to allow straightforward single-step introduction of diverse aryl groups.
